Settlement Amounts: A General Overview
Settlement in mesothelioma lawsuits can differ significantly based upon several elements, including the complainant's specific scenarios, jurisdiction, and the proof provided. Below is a breakdown of possible payment types and amounts:
Types of Compensation
Economic Damages: These are concrete expenses associated with the illness, consisting of:
Medical expenditures: Treatment costs, health center stays, medications, and rehabilitation.Lost wages: Income lost due to inability to work throughout treatment.Future profits: Projected lost earnings if the plaintiff can no longer work.
Non-Economic Damages: These cover intangible losses, such as:
Pain and suffering: Physical discomfort and psychological distress caused by the disease.Loss of consortium: Impact on relationships with member of the family and loved ones.
Compensatory damages: In cases of gross carelessness or willful misbehavior, courts may award punitive damages to punish the responsible parties and discourage similar habits in the future.

Pursuing a Mesothelioma Lawsuit Trial Process lawsuit can be intricate, and it is essential to understand the actions included:

Consultation: Seek a customized lawyer with experience in asbestos-related litigation.

Investigation: Gather evidence, consisting of medical records and occupational history, to develop a connection in between asbestos exposure and the medical diagnosis.

Filing a Claim: Your attorney will help file the lawsuit within the statute of limitations, which differs by state.

Settlement: Many cases settle out of court. Legal groups will work out with the accused's insurance provider to reach a reasonable settlement.

Trial: If a settlement can not be reached, the case may continue to trial, where a jury will determine the outcome.
FAQs About Mesothelioma Lawsuit Compensation1. How long does it require to receive payment after filing a lawsuit?
The timeline can vary greatly, depending on whether the case settles or goes to trial. The majority of settlements occur within a couple of months to a few years, while trials might take longer.
2. Can I submit a lawsuit if the asbestos direct exposure was decades ago?
Yes, you can file a lawsuit even if the direct exposure took place several years prior. Nevertheless, it's vital to consult an attorney promptly due to state-specific statutes of limitations.
3. What if the deceased client had not yet submitted a lawsuit?
Enduring relative might submit a wrongful death lawsuit on behalf of the deceased. It allows the household to look for payment Tips For Mesothelioma Lawsuit their loss and associated expenditures.
4. Are there any caps on settlement for mesothelioma suits?
Certain states have caps on non-economic damages, limiting the quantity a plaintiff can recuperate. Nevertheless, economic damages (like medical costs and lost wages) are normally not capped.
